Cordiform meaning

Cordiform means heart-shaped, with the word heart being the key characteristic.

A cordiform shape refers to any object that resembles a heart or has a heart-like outline. The term "cordiform" is derived from the Latin words "cor," meaning heart, and "forma," meaning shape or form.

Origin of Cordiform

Cordiform shapes can be found in various natural formations such as leaves, fruits, and rocks. The heart shape has long been associated with love, affection, and emotions, making it a popular symbol in art, culture, and literature.

Examples of Cordiform Objects

One of the most famous representations of a cordiform shape is the iconic heart symbol, which is widely used to express love and romance. In nature, fruits like strawberries and cherries often exhibit a cordiform form, as well as certain leaves and flowers.
